Mexico into the top six: Re-ranking the 48 World Cup teams after day 20 - The Athletic

The New York Times · July 02, 2026

The United States, England, and Belgium advanced to the knockout round of the 2026 FIFA World Cup on day 21, with the U.S. defeating Bosnia and Herzegovina despite a red card, England overcoming DR Congo behind Harry Kane's two goals, and Belgium mounting a dramatic late comeback against Senegal from 2-0 down. France remains atop The Athletic's rankings after a 3-0 win over Sweden, with a 29 percent projected chance of winning the tournament, while Argentina and Brazil also progressed comfortably through their group stages.
